Černá Hora was formerly part of the German Empire. In the German Empire, the place was called Schwarzenberg.
The place is now called Černá Hora and belongs to Czech Republic.
Historical place name | Country | Administration | Time |
---|---|---|---|
Schwarzenberg | Austro-Hungary | Trautenau | before the Treaty of Saint-Germain |
Černá Hora | Czechoslovakia | Trutnov | after the Treaty of Saint-Germain |
Schwarzenberg | Czechoslovakia | Trutnov | after the Treaty of Saint-Germain |
Schwarzenberg | German Empire | Trautenau | 1938 |
Černá Hora | Czechoslovakia | Trutnov | 1945 |
Černá Hora | Czechoslovakia | Trutnov | 1992 |
Černá Hora | Czech Republic | Trutnov | 1993 |
